What is an Island Cooker Hood?

An island cooker hood is a ventilation system particularly created for kitchen islands. Unlike conventional hoods that install against a wall, island range cooker island hoods hang from the ceiling, straight above the cooking surface area. Their main function is to catch smoke, steam, grease, and odors produced during cooking, improving air quality and ensuring a pleasant cooking experience.

Setup Considerations

Setting up an island cooker hood needs careful preparation and consideration. Here are important factors to bear in mind:

  • Ceiling Height: The distance from the cooktop to the hood need to ideally be in between 30 to 36 inches for ideal air capture and safety.
  • Ducting Requirements: If you choose a ducted hood, guarantee that the ceiling can accommodate the needed ductwork for venting.
  • Electrical Wiring: Proper electrical setups should be made to power the hood, specifically if it has advanced functions like lighting and fans.
  • Weight Support: Consider the structural integrity of the ceiling, as island hoods can be heavy and require sufficient support for safe installation.
  • Regional Building Codes: Always examine regional policies and structure codes to make sure compliance.

Maintenance Tips

To make sure the durability and performance of an white Island range hood cooker hood, regular upkeep is essential. Here are some ideas:

  • Clean Filters Regularly: Depending on usage, grease filters should be cleaned up monthly; charcoal filters may need changing every 6-- 12 months.
  • Clean Down the Exterior: Regularly tidy the exterior casing with a mild cleaner to eliminate spots and white island range Hood grease accumulation.
  • Examine for Blockages: Inspect ductwork routinely to guarantee it's not obstructed, which can minimize efficiency.
  • Professional Servicing: Consider having the unit expertly serviced every year to look for any mechanical concerns.

Frequently Asked Questions about Island Cooker Hoods

What is the distinction in between ducted and ductless island cooker hoods?

Ducted hoods vent air outside, providing the best ventilation, while ductless hoods filter and recirculate air inside the kitchen. Ducted hoods are typically more efficient however require more extensive setup.

How do you know what size island hood to select?

The size of the hood ought to typically match the width of your cooking surface area. A general rule of thumb is to have a hood that is at least as large as the cooktop surface for optimum efficiency.

Are island cooker hoods loud?

The sound level can differ amongst various models. When acquiring, it's suggested to examine the sound score (measured in sones) to choose a model that fits your comfort level.

Can I install an island cooker hood myself?

While some homeowners might go with DIY installation, it is often advised to work with an expert, specifically if electrical and ductwork adjustments are required.

How often should I clean my island hood?

Clean the grease filters on a monthly basis and inspect charcoal filters every 6-12 months for replacement. Frequently wiping the exterior is also recommended.
